包括PHP中的远程文件

我无法在我的PHP脚本中包含一个远程PHP文件。我想我的托管更改了php设置。


我使用的代码是:


include "http://domain.com/folder/file.php";

如何允许使用php.ini / .htaccess启用包含功能?


还有其他解决方法吗?


谢谢。


扬帆大鱼
浏览 320回答 2
2回答

海绵宝宝撒

要使用远程包含,必须在php.ini中设置allow_url_fopen和allow_url_include选项。请注意,如果远程服务器启用了php,则将获得该远程脚本的输出,而不是脚本本身的输出。如果确实要获取源代码,则可以在远程服务器上添加一个符号链接,例如ln -s file.php file.php.source,然后使包含引用文件为file.php.source。
打开App,查看更多内容
随时随地看视频慕课网APP